New Deputy Lieutenants Appointed
On Tuesday 14th February The Lord-Lieutenant appointed five new Deputy Lieutenants for Surrey:
Major General Aidan Michael Gerard Smyth QVRM TD – Waverley
Brigadier Ingrid Anne Rolland VR – Redhill
Dr Julie Llewelyn – Waverley
Dame Lynne Owens DCB, CBE, QPM – Surrey
Mr Mark Tantam – Tandridge
We are delighted to be able to welcome these new Deputy Lieutenants, whose breadth of experience will further enhance our already strong team of Deputies who currently support the Lord-Lieutenant and act as the eyes and ears for the Lieutenancy across Surrey.
